Dana's Yellow Squash and Zucchini Casserole

A simple and delicious side dish that has layers of green and yellow squash.
Prep Time15 minutes
Cook Time1 hour
Total Time1 hour 15 minutes
Servings: 6

Ingredients

  • 1 large sweet onion diced
  • 1 tbs olive oil
  • 4 cups sliced zucchini
  • 4 cups sliced yellow squash
  • 3/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 4 eggs beaten
  • 1/3 cup dry bread crumbs
  • 3 tablespoons melted butter

Instructions

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F.
  • Thinly slice the yellow squash and the zucchini
  • Heat a skillet to medium/high heat. Add 1 tbs of the olive oil and saute the sweet onion.
  • Spray an 8x8-inch baking dish with vegetable spray.
  • Alternate the yellow squash and the zucchini in a single layer. Add 1/3 of the sauteed sweet onions. Then sprinkle with a handful of the cheese.
  • Continue with two more layers and a final layer of the zucchini and yellow squash.
  • Beat the eggs in a bowl and then drizzle beaten eggs over the squash.
  • Sprinkle the top with bread crumbs. Melt the remaining butter and pour it over the top.
  • Bake the casserole for 60-75 minutes, or until the top is nicely browned and the zucchini is soft and tender.
  • Serve immediately.
